1. Dior Forever Powder: This is arguably Dior's flagship loose powder, often referenced when discussing their offerings. The description "Poudre dior forever; Poudre libre: matifie, lisse et unifie le teint" perfectly encapsulates its core function. The "Dior Forever" line is renowned for its long-lasting wear and ability to create a flawless, even complexion. The powder itself is incredibly fine and silky, blending seamlessly into the skin without settling into fine lines or pores. This is crucial for fulfilling the promise of "sans marquer les traits" (without marking the features). Its mattifying properties effectively control shine throughout the day, making it ideal for those with oily or combination skin. The unification aspect is achieved through its subtle color-correcting capabilities, helping to even out skin tone and minimize the appearance of imperfections.
